The real estate market in Brentwood is heating up.

The suburban Los Angeles neighborhood has seen an uptick in prime luxury listings, likely accommodating residents that have been displaced by the recent fires.

We’ve seen a grand home with architectural pedigree listing at $30 million, another $40 million architectural with a funicular and glamping yurts, and now a sleek, contemporary gem is hitting the market for a hefty $41.95 million.

The sellers: none other than Formula 1 heiress Petra Ecclestone — daughter of English Formula One billionaire Bernie Ecclestone — and her husband, luxury real estate agent Sam Palmer of The Agency, the brokerage from the Netflix reality series Buying Beverly Hills.

Both Petra and Palmer are well versed in luxury real estate. The couple owned the former Spelling Manor in Holmby Hills, which they sold for $119 million in 2019, a record at the time. In 2022, they purchased a Brentwood estate on Tigertail Road for $22 million and later sold it for $36 million, holding the record sale for that year.

Now blending “architectural sophistication with an inviting California sensibility”, according to the listing, the 7-bedroom home was completely revamped in 2024 by Petra herself, who’s an accomplished fashion designer, and Sam, well-versed in luxury real estate.

If, like me, you associate Ecclestone with The Manor and its palatial interiors and sweeping curved staircases, you’ll be pleasantly surprised by the couple’s latest real estate venture. The house at 250 S Rockingham Avenue is distinctly modern, with a black facade and warm, wood-clad interiors.

Over 13,500 square feet of living space across three levels

The Brentwood home sits on over half an acre of manicured grounds, offering privacy and elegance in one of Los Angeles’s most sought-after neighborhoods.

It spans approximately 13,500 square feet across three levels, featuring 7 bedrooms, 9.5 bathrooms, and lush outdoor areas with a pool, a soccer pitch, and a custom treehouse.

Additional features include a dedicated staff area with kitchen, lounge, dog room, and a security suite with the latest monitoring technology. The estate also offers a garage and motor court parking for up to 12 vehicles, with a carriage-style driveway for guests.

Standout design elements include twelve-foot ceilings, white oak floors

Twelve-foot ceilings rise across all three floors, complemented by hand-applied Roman plaster walls and wide-plank white oak floors in soft, neutral tones.

With a formal room that seats 20

The main level flows through three distinct sitting areas, dual offices, and a formal dining room that seats 20 guests.

Upstairs, five bedrooms each with an ensuite bath anchor the private wing, with the primary bedroom featuring vaulted ceilings, dual spa-inspired bathrooms, two custom dressing rooms, and a private terrace with treetop views.

An open kitchen connects to a secondary chef’s kitchen

At the heart of the home — dubbed Two Fifty South, after its address at 250 S Rockingham Avenue — is a welcoming open kitchen with an oversized center island connected to a fully appointed secondary chef’s kitchen, designed for entertaining.

An amenity-rich backyard

The amenities are neatly tucked away on the lower level. Here, a curated collection of amenities includes a golf simulator, bar, guest suite, gym with steam room, and a private movie theater.

But there are quite a few outside too, including a pool with wood decking, hot and cold plunge pools, and outdoor shower, and a thoughtfully placed soccer pitch
